RCW 50.04.160

Services performed in domestic service in a private home, local college club, or local chapter of a college fraternity or sorority shall not be considered services in employment unless the services are performed after December 31, 1977, for a person who paid remuneration of one thousand dollars or more to individuals employed in this domestic service in any calendar quarter in the current or the preceding calendar year. The terms local college club and local chapter of a college fraternity or sorority shall not be deemed to include alumni clubs or chapters.
[ 1977 ex.s. c 292 s 4 ; 1947 c 215 s 4 ; 1945 c 35 s 17 ; Rem. Supp. 1947 s 9998-156. Prior: 1943 c 127 s 13 ; 1941 c 253 s 14 ; 1939 c 214 s 16 ; 1937 c 162 s 19 .]
